Device Compatibility

The app is built exclusively for Android devices. It works smoothly across virtually all recent Android versions, starting as low as Android 4.0 and running optimally on newer systems (such as Android 5.1 or later). The lightweight coding keeps it accessible on both high-end models and the modest budget phones popular among students and young users.

  • Quick installation and start-up due to compact design.
  • No lagging even when streaming action-packed titles like Attack on Titan or Naruto.
  • Works with most Android brands commonly available worldwide.

Testing it on a mid-range phone, I didn’t experience hiccups episodes started swiftly, video stayed sharp, and navigation felt intuitive, whether I was watching an episode of Horimiya or browsing for new manga titles.

Accessibility Limitations

While the Samehadaku app offers an impressive toolkit, there are natural boundaries that some users must navigate.

  • The primary language is Indonesian, with all subtitles and the interface designed for local audiences. English-speaking users may find this challenging unless they are learning or familiar with Indonesian.
  • Access is Android-only, meaning iOS and other platform users are not supported.
  • The app interface, including navigation buttons and help tips, is tuned to typical Indonesian browsing patterns. International users might face an initial learning curve, but most basic actions are still readily understandable thanks to universal media symbols (play, pause, back).

Despite those hurdles, many international users choose the app for its massive anime and manga library and timely content sometimes using it as a supplementary resource while relying on other platforms for English language viewing.
